Early Remdesivir Use Linked to Lower Graft Loss in Kidney Transplant Recipients with COVID-19

Kidney transplant recipients diagnosed with COVID-19 who received the antiviral medication remdesivir (Veklury) early in their illness demonstrated a significantly lower risk of losing their transplanted kidney graft. This crucial finding stems from a target trial emulation study, a sophisticated research methodology designed to approximate the rigor of a randomized controlled trial by analyzing existing observational data. The study meticulously compared the outcomes of kidney transplant recipients who initiated remdesivir treatment within seven days of symptom onset against a control group that did not receive the antiviral.

The primary outcome of interest in this investigation was graft loss, a devastating complication for individuals who have undergone organ transplantation. The results revealed a statistically significant benefit associated with the early administration of remdesivir, positioning it as a valuable therapeutic intervention for this particularly vulnerable patient population. Kidney transplant recipients are inherently immunocompromised due to the necessity of lifelong immunosuppressive medications, which are vital to prevent their bodies from rejecting the transplanted organ. This state of compromised immunity renders them more susceptible to severe infections, including COVID-19, and increases their risk of experiencing more severe disease progression and potentially life-threatening complications.

Remdesivir, marketed as Veklury, is an antiviral medication developed by Gilead Sciences. Its mechanism of action involves inhibiting viral RNA replication, thereby curtailing the virus's ability to multiply within the body. The U.S. Food and Drug Administration (FDA) has previously authorized remdesivir for emergency use and subsequently granted full approval for the treatment of COVID-19 in specific adult and pediatric patient populations. Its application in immunocompromised individuals, such as organ transplant recipients, is of paramount importance given their heightened susceptibility to severe illness and adverse outcomes from viral infections.

The target trial emulation design employed in this study is particularly noteworthy. By carefully selecting and analyzing patient data to mirror the inclusion and exclusion criteria of a hypothetical randomized controlled trial, researchers aimed to mitigate potential biases inherent in observational studies. This approach enhances the reliability and interpretability of the findings. The study's conclusions contribute substantially to the expanding body of evidence guiding the management of COVID-19 in solid organ transplant recipients and provide a clear, evidence-based recommendation for clinicians caring for these patients, emphasizing the critical window for initiating antiviral therapy.
